OverviewIn the highly capital-intensive electricity supply industry, it is essential that both engineers and managers understand the methodologies of project evaluation in order to comprehend and analyse investment proposals and decisions. This updated and expanded edition of Economic Evaluation of Projects in the Electricity Supply Industry takes a broad introductory approach, covering planning and investment, financial analysis and evaluation, risk management, electricity trading, and strategies, technologies, national requirements and global agreements for electricity generation in a carbon-constrained world. Developments covered by this new edition include the changing mix of fuels in the power generation sector, greater involvement of the private sector in power generation investments through independent power producers, the important role of regulations, the growing interest in clean electricity generation, the economics of investing in renewables, the introduction of smart grids and intelligent meters and networks, and cyber security. Economic Evaluation of Projects in the Electricity Supply Industry, 3rd Edition is essential reading for academic and industrial engineers and economists concerned with energy supply, students of energy economics and planning, industry planners and project managers, and government and regulatory officials. Table of ContentsChapter 1: Global electrical power planning, investments and projects Chapter 2: Considerations in project evaluation Chapter 3: Time value of money (discounting) Chapter 4: Choice of the discount rate Chapter 5: Financial evaluation of projects Chapter 6: Considerations in project evaluation Chapter 7: Economic evaluation of projects Chapter 8: Environmental considerations, cost estimation and long term discounting in project evaluation Chapter 9: Electricity generation in a carbon-constrained world: Part I - The strategies, national requirements and global agreements Chapter 10: Electricity generation in a carbon-constrained world: Part II - The technologies Chapter 11: Economics of reliability of the power supply Chapter 12: Economics of new renewables: is there viable energy at the end of the renewables tunnel?
